About the Team:

The Propulsion team at Relativity is focused on developing and delivering highly performant and manufacturable engines for Terran R. Engineers are responsible for the entire lifecycle of their parts, from initial design through production to qualification and flight. The team fosters a culture of bottoms-up decision-making, free from technical gatekeeping, where ownership and accountability are key at all levels. But designing engines with a quarter million pounds of thrust is just the beginning. As the flight configuration enters qualification, the team is now exploring modifications for future engines, including thrust upgrades, new cycles, and design for mass production.

About the Role:

This role may span several areas of our team depending on your skillset and the team's needs at the time. The core technical responsibilities of the role & of your team are driving engine system (architecture + CONOPS) trades, managing engine interfaces & negotiating requirements to optimize for the vehicle, and supporting engine system development overall. You may additionally support engine system analysis and simulation, engine testing, tool development, and more. In engineering at the system level, you will be expected not just to coordinate & facilitate amongst other technical teams, but to bring your own deep technical acumen to bear on problems in this highly technical role - and to coach the folks on your team to do the same.

You will also lead a team of engineers with similar responsibilities as the above. This will require mentorship, project management, establishing priorities, communicating with leadership, providing technical guidance, and recruiting. Leaders at Relativity are expected to be both people leaders & highly technical - you will balance your time between effectively supporting your team's growth and success at Relativity and making direct technical contributions of your own. You will serve as a mentor to guide the team, but will also learn from peers & mentors of your own within propulsion & the broader company. And in addition to learning from each other, we all learn from the engine - Aeon R is a novel engine that's never been built before, and with every engine test it gives us new mysteries to solve and challenges to grow from.
